Enhanced Power Saving Scheme for IEEE 802.11 PSM

  • Power management is an important technique to prolong the lifetime of battery-powered wireless Ad Hoc networks. This paper analyzes the Power Saving Mechanism (PSM) of IEEE 802.11 Distributed Coordination Function (DCF) and presents a self-adaptive power saving mechanism, which consists of three different beacon intervals. In the new scheme the node selects one of the three beacon intervals dynamically, depending on its traffic. Simulation results show that the new scheme not only improves the efficiency of energy greatly but also achieves desirable transmission delay and throughput.
